Reliance’s e-commerce platform cashes in on Dhurandhar hype with new merch line

The limited-edition range is based on themes and characters from the film and aims to offer fans apparel inspired by the movie.
The collection includes graphic T-shirts featuring movie quotes, signature tees inspired by actor Ranveer Singh, and limited-edition signed Pathanis. The line also features designs inspired by the on-screen style of Sara Arjun.
According to the company, the merchandise collection starts at Rs 349 and is intended to connect film audiences with fashion inspired by the movie.
AJIO said the collaboration is part of its strategy to introduce fashion collections linked to entertainment properties and pop culture.
Dhurandhar, produced by Jio Studios and B62 Studios, has been described by the makers as a spy-action thriller featuring large-scale storytelling and prominent characters.
The sequel, titled Dhurandhar: The Revenge, written and directed by Aditya Dhar, is scheduled to release in theatres worldwide on March 19, 2026.
"Dhurandhar" is the highest-grossing Hindi film of all time after its release last year. The first instalment of the movie, starring Akshaye Khanna, Ranveer Singh, R Madhavan, Sanjay Dutt and Arjun Rampal in the lead roles.
The sequel is expected to continue from the cliffhanger ending.
The sequel's recently released trailer features Ranveer Singh appearing in dual personas as Jaskirat and Hamza. R. Madhavan returns as strategist Ajay Sanyal, with Arjun Rampal as ISI Major Iqbal and Sanjay Dutt as SP Chaudhary Aslam.
Aditya Dhar wrote, directed and produced the film. Jyoti Deshpande and Lokesh Dhar also produce. The sequel will release in Hindi, Telugu, Tamil, Kannada and Malayalam languages.
